Meaning
Zaina is an Arabic name with a rich history and beautiful meaning. It is primarily given to girls and signifies “grace,” “beauty,” or “ornament.” The name’s elegance and positive connotations have made it popular across various cultures.
The Arabic root of Zaina is the verb “zayn,” which means “to beautify” or “to adorn.” This root gives rise to several related words in Arabic, all carrying the essence of beauty, attractiveness, or refinement. This deep-seated linguistic connection underscores the name’s inherent meaning and cultural significance.
The use of Zaina as a personal name reflects a longstanding tradition in Arabic-speaking societies where names often carry profound symbolic weight. Parents choose names that they believe will reflect desirable qualities for their children, and Zaina embodies grace, beauty, and inner radiance – traits highly valued across cultures.
